Heterogeneous server rules
Supports HP Serviceguard Clusters.
Zoning is required when HP-UX is used in a heterogeneous SAN with other operating systems.

Host name profile must be set to HP-UX
Support for HP-UX 11i v2 (June 2008 or later) using PvLinks (for MSA2000fc G2 products only)
Support for HP-UX 11i v3 using native multipathing
Active/active failover mode is supported for HP-UX 11i v1 and 11i v2 using the Secure Path, PvLinks,
or Veritas DMP driver. HP-UX 11i v3 is supported with native multipathing.
